Started by a former sports anchor frustrated with the amount of time he was given to report the sports news; with a $9,000 credit card advance and $30,000 from friends and family.
ESPN
Started by the founder of The Cable Educational Network, Inc with $5 million in start-up capital led by investment firm Allen & Company
THE DISCOVERY CHANNEL
Started by a lobbyist for the cable industry looking to create the first network aimed at African Americans with a loan of $15,000 and a $500,000 investment.
BET NETWORK

LAYOFFS AFFECT MTV, OTHER NETWORKS, AS VIACOM RESTRUCTURING CONTINUES
VARIETY March 10, 2015
Viacom expected to cut around $250 million in costs as a result of the restructuring.
ESPN CUTS 300 JOBS AS SUBSCRIBER FEE GROWTH SLOWS
LA TIMES October 21, 2015
ESPN has been under pressure to control costs as it no longer can depend on steady growth from its most reliable revenue
stream: fees from cable and satellite subscribers
HBO TO CUT 7% OF ITS WORKFORCE BEGINNING THIS WEEK
DEADLINE HOLLYWOOD October 28, 2014
Time Warner’s directive to its divisions to cut head count, part of the media giant’s effort to improve profitability, hits the
premium network operation this week

...SO WHAT HAPPENED TO THOSECABLE NETWORKS?
SOME ROLLED UP SMALLER PLAYERS
“ABC to Acquire ESPN as Texaco Sells It’s 72%”LOS ANGELES TIMES August, 27, 1985
“CBS Corp. Will Acquire TNN and CMT for Stock Valued at 1.55B”ADVERTISING AGE February 11, 1997
“NBC to Buy Bravo Channel in $1.25B Deal”THE NEW YORK TIMES November 4, 2002
“Weather Channel is Sold to NBC and Equity Firms”THE NEW YORK TIMES July 7, 2008
...MANY GOT ACQUIRED BY THE MEDIA BUSINESSES WHO CAME BEFORE THEM
“Turner to Merge into Time Warner; A $7.5B Deal”THE NEW YORK TIMES September 23, 1995
Viacom Set to Acquire CBS in Biggest Media Merger EverTHE NEW YORK TIMES September 8, 1999
“Comcast to Buy NBC Universal”MASHABLE December 1, 2009
...AND SOME SOLD TO THE PIPE OWNERS
